The history of Hanfu wrist straps can be traced back to the ancient times, when they were used to hold the sleeves in place and also served as a means of securing the clothing. Over time, they evolved to become a decorative element that added to the beauty and uniqueness of Hanfu. The materials used in their making range from silk to cotton, with intricate embroidery and beading adding to their beauty.

The design and pattern of Hanfu wrist straps vary depending on the type of Hanfu being worn and the occasion. For instance, for formal occasions like weddings or festivals, wrist straps are often adorned with intricate patterns and designs that match the color scheme of the attire. They are often embroidered with symbols that represent good luck and prosperity, adding a cultural significance to the attire.

On a practical level, wrist straps serve a dual purpose. Besides enhancing the beauty of the attire, they also help in keeping the sleeves in place and preventing them from slipping off during movements. The straps provide a secure fit, ensuring that the wearer remains comfortable throughout the event or occasion.
